I have absolutely no idea of the bearing capacity of your soil. Soil capacities vary greatly from less than half a ton per square foot for loose soil to over 100 tons per square foot for solid rock.

To get an idea of the foundation size take the weight on any column and divide by its area to get the foot pressure.
Now imagine this spreads out at 45 degrees from this level. As the area increases the load remains the same, so the pressure decreases. At some point this pressure equals to bearing competency of the soil.
This is your foundation level. You will need a block of concrete to fill the space between this level and the foot of the column. The area of the concrete block obviously equals the weight on the column divided by the allowable bearing pressure on your soil.
